Transaction 72a7809db128dc546b603c5725af782284e2ca75b49c359b00550b59e32a41f2

2 Input
1 Outputs
  • 72a7809db128dc546b603c5725af782284e2ca75b49c359b00550b59e32a41f2:0
  • value  15983181
    address  37uTdRVpyMMyV2uzKS6UZuHMp9nd7FETie